+The repeatedly transmitted data is "Hello World!\r\n", using various settings,
+such as 8n1, 8o1, 8e1, 7o1, 7e1, etc.
+
+The hardware sending the data is an Olimex STM32-H103 eval kit with an
+ST STM32 (ARM Cortex-M3) microcontroller. The firmware used is based on a
+simple libopencm3 UART example. The USART1 (USART1.TX pin) is used.
